Windows: Description and Operation
CIRCUIT DESCRIPTIONA permanent magnet motor operates each of the power windows. Each motor raises or lowers the glass when voltage is supplied to it. The direction the motor turns depends on the polarity of the supply voltage. The power window main switch in the driver door module controls the operation of all the power window motors.
Each power window switch controls its own power window motor and has two opposite relays controlled by ETACM or door modules. If the window lock switch is depressed(LOCK), the passenger power windows(assister door window, rear left/right door window) can not be controlled by their own window switches. However, they can still be controlled by the power window main switch.
